Stroll aiming for Racing Point to top "very tight" midfield

2019-05-03 18:58:03 by Adam Newton

Lance Stroll is aiming to help Racing Point to a fourth placed finish this year, equalling what the squad achieved in 2016 and 2017, when they were known as Force India.

Stroll made a controversial switch to Racing Point in the winter, replacing Esteban Ocon, but has scored points in two of the four races, including a ninth placed finish last time out in Azerbaijan.

Combine that with Sergio Perez’s eight-point haul for finishing sixth and it made for a good result for Racing Point in Baku, one that put them just one point behind fourth placed McLaren.

Stroll told Sky Sports: “It’s going to be a development race all the way to the end of the season.

“The midfield is very, very tight, just a couple of tenths between fourth to ninth teams, so it’s very, very tight, but it’s going to be a good battle all the way to the end and we’re going to try and bring some pace to Barcelona.

“Absolutely, we’re aiming for a big result this season. There’s a long way to go though, it’s early days.”
